Meaning
Excavator rubber track pads are protective attachments designed to be fitted onto excavator tracks. These pads serve multiple purposes, including reducing ground pressure to prevent surface damage, enhancing traction for improved maneuverability, and minimizing noise levels during operation. By providing a cushioning effect and distributing weight evenly, rubber track pads help to extend the lifespan of both the excavator tracks and the underlying surfaces, making them indispensable accessories for construction projects of all scales.

Market Restraints
- High Initial Cost: The initial cost of purchasing and installing rubber track pads for excavators can be relatively high, especially for large-scale construction projects with extensive equipment fleets. This cost factor may deter some contractors from investing in track pad solutions, particularly in regions with budget constraints.
- Compatibility Issues: Ensuring compatibility between rubber track pads and various excavator models can be challenging, particularly for aftermarket track pad suppliers. Contractors may encounter compatibility issues during installation, leading to additional time and costs.
- Maintenance Requirements: While rubber track pads offer numerous benefits, they also require regular maintenance to ensure optimal performance and longevity. Contractors must factor in maintenance costs and downtime associated with track pad replacement and repairs.

Category-wise Insights
- Construction Industry: The construction industry is the primary end-user segment for excavator rubber track pads, driven by infrastructure development projects, residential and commercial construction, and urbanization trends.
- Mining Sector: The mining sector represents another significant market segment for rubber track pads, where excavators are used for various mining operations such as excavation, material handling, and site preparation.
- Forestry Applications: Rubber track pads are utilized in forestry applications where excavators are employed for tasks such as land clearing, logging, and forestry management. Track pads help minimize surface damage in sensitive forest environments.
- Agricultural Operations: In the agricultural sector, rubber track pads are utilized in excavators for tasks such as land preparation, irrigation, and drainage. These track pads help protect agricultural land and minimize soil compaction.
